macOSソフトウェアのアップデート後に再起動するたびにプログレスバーが完了するのを待つことにうんざりしている場合は、ダウンタイムを減らす可能性のあるMacをアップデートする別の方法があることを知って喜ぶでしょう。
このプロセスには単純なターミナルコマンドが含まれ、アップデートのダウンロードとソフトウェアの初期インストールがバックグラウンドで行われるため、Macを引き続き使用できます。私たちのテストでは、この方法でインストールの再起動中に数分のアイドル時間を短縮できることがわかりましたが、時間の節約はマシンと問題のアップデートによって異なります。
特に古いMacを使用しているユーザーは、このヒントを高く評価するでしょう。MacAppStoreを完全に起動する必要がなくなり、処理が遅くなり、場合によってはまったく応答しなくなることもあります。それがどのように行われるかを知るために読んでください。
コマンドラインからmacOSを更新する方法
これらの手順を実行する前に、システムの完全バックアップがあることを確認してください。これは、更新を実行するときのコースと同等である必要があります。次の手順では、ストックのAppleシステムアップデート(iTunes、Photos、プリンタドライバなど)のみを一覧表示し、macOSがインストールされていない他のAppleアプリ(Xcodeなど)のアップデートは一覧表示せず、サードパーティのアップデートは一覧表示しないことに注意してください。 Mac AppStore。
- コマンドラインからmacOSを更新するには、最初に起動します ターミナル 、アプリケーション/ユーティリティフォルダにあります。これにより、ターミナルウィンドウが開き、入力を開始するためのコマンドプロンプトが表示されます。
- 次のコマンドを入力して、Enterキーを押します。 ソフトウェアアップデート-l
- MacがAppleのサーバーを検索して、システムで現在利用可能なmacOSソフトウェアアップデートを探します。利用可能なアップデートがない場合は、コマンドプロンプトに戻ります。
次に、コマンドの出力を見てみましょう。利用可能なアップデートは常にリストのアイテムとして表示されます。この例では、現時点で利用できる更新は1つだけですが、次のように、すべてのアイテムが同じ形式に従います。
アスタリスクの付いた線は、Macがダウンロードできる個々のソフトウェアアップデートパッケージを示しています。この行は識別子とも呼ばれます。
2行目は、バージョン番号(通常は括弧内)やダウンロードファイルのサイズ(キロバイト単位)など、更新のより詳細な説明を提供します。 [推奨]は、すべてのユーザーにアップデートが推奨されることを意味し、[再起動]は、インストールを完了するためにMacを再起動する必要があることを示します。
リスト内の特定の更新をダウンロードしてインストールするには、次の形式を使用しますが、 名前 更新の識別子を使用して:
ソフトウェアアップデート-iNAME
または:
softwareupdate --install NAME
インストールしようとしているパッケージ名にスペースが含まれている場合は、すべてを一重引用符で囲む必要があることに注意してください。したがって、たとえば:
softwareupdate --install'macOS High Sierra10.13.3補足アップデート-'
また、パッケージ名の末尾のスペースにも注意してください。存在する場合は、それらも引用符に含める必要があります。
次に、システムの特定の更新をその場でインストールせずにダウンロードするには、次を使用できます。
softwareupdate -d NAME
この方法でダウンロードされたアップデートは、後で同じものを使用してインストールできます -私 また - インストール 上記のコマンド、またはMac AppStoreからも。これらの更新は/ Library / Updatesにあるフォルダーにダウンロードされますが、そのディレクトリー内のパッケージをダブルクリックしてインストールするようには設計されていません。を使用する必要があります - インストール コマンドを実行するか、Mac App Storeにアクセスして、実際にインストールを開始します。
最後に、システムで利用可能なすべての更新をダウンロードしてインストールするには、次のコマンドを入力します。
softwareupdate -i -a
これらのコマンドを使用すると、アップデートを残してダウンロードし、他の作業をしている間、バックグラウンドでインストールを続けることができます。すべてが順調であるため、ターミナルは最終的に、完全なインストール手順を完了することができるように、マシンを手動で再起動するように促します。 (softwareupdateユーティリティでは、-lまたは-listコマンドを除くすべてのコマンドに管理者認証が必要であることに注意してください。通常の管理者ユーザーとしてsoftwareupdateを実行すると、必要に応じてパスワードの入力を求められます。)
一部のユーザーは間違いなく気付くでしょうが、softwareupdateユーティリティと組み合わせて使用できるいくつかの追加オプションがあります。例えば、 -スケジュールのオン/オフ Macのスケジュールされた更新のバックグラウンドチェックを有効/無効にします。より冒険的な読者は使用することができます 男のソフトウェアアップデート と ソフトウェアアップデート-h コマンドの要約リストについては。
人気の投稿